Engaging in regular resistance training is known to lead to several beneficial physiological adaptations, one of which is an increase in Basal Metabolic Rate (BMR). BMR refers to the number of calories your body requires to maintain basic physiological functions at rest, such as breathing, circulation, and cell production.

When a person participates in resistance training, there is an increase in muscle mass. Muscle tissue is metabolically active, meaning it burns more calories at rest compared to fat tissue. As a result, the more lean muscle one has, the higher their metabolic rate will generally be. Therefore, through regular resistance training, a person can effectively boost their BMR, leading to enhanced calorie expenditure even while at rest.

This increase in muscle mass and BMR also plays a crucial role in weight management and overall metabolic health, linking the importance of resistance training to both physical fitness and long-term health benefits.
